Abstract

An CMOS interconnection method that permits small source/drain surface areas has been provided. The interconnection is applicable to both strap and via type connections. The surface areas of the small source/drain regions are extended into neighboring field oxide regions by forming a silicide film from the source/drain regions to the field oxide. Interconnections on the same metal level, or to another metal level are made by contact to the silicide covered field oxide. The source/drain regions need only be large enough to accept the silicide film. Transistors with small source/drain regions have smaller drain leakage currents and less parasitic capacitance. A CMOS transistor interconnection apparatus has also been provided.
